VANCOUVER, Wash. – The William Carey Men's Cross Country Team competed in the 2023 NAIA Cross Country National Championship with the women having three individuals compete Friday afternoon, at the Fort Vancouver Historical Course.
For the men,
Carson Barlow helped the Crusaders to a 30
th place finish with a time of 26:02 in the 8K event to finish in the top 75 for the second-straight season.
Nathan Sury clocked in at 27:20 to finish in 233
rd with
Seth Kramlich coming in 254
th with a time of 27:35. Next to cross the finish line were
Alex Beeler and
Gavin Wheat with times of 28:05 and 28:13.
Owen Jensen and
Javon Lee rounded out the squad posting time of 28:19 and 30:35.
For the ladies,
Blanca Conesa climbed from 68th last year to 41st this season with a time of 22:45 in the 5K event. Mario Tirado was next with a time of 23:21 to place 72
nd with
Isabelle Wheeler posting a time 24:51.
